NEWS, COMPANIES, DASS-ADDED-FILA-BRAND-TO-ITS-PRODUCTION
The Brazilian company that arrived in Argentina in 2007 and has invested US$ 185 million, has two industrial plants, in Coronel Suárez (province of Bs.As.) and Eldorado (Misiones), with a total of 1,500 workers. With an average production of 304 thousand pairs per month, DASS estimates to reach 3.3 million pairs by the end of the year, which represents an increase of 20% in its local manufacturing, compared to last year.In the Misiones establishment, the ADIDAS and REEBOK brands are produced, while in Coronel Suárez, NIKE, UMBRO, ASICS and UNDER ARMOUR are manufactured.The incorporation of FILA meant the installation of 2 more lines for production and 100 new jobs.
